I won't comment on Montero's statement because I did not see that and that's not the point I was making.
Added weight can benefit you in mass but it can also hurt you in explosiveness, especially if it's a weight your not used to operating at. It also matters how that mass was added.
Fortuna's weight is a red flag to me because it's indicative of poor preparation. In the broadcast, Mannix mentioned that the bout was at 140 because Fortuna couldn't make lightweight. I don't recall him ever fighting that heavy before and he rehydrated to 157. Fortuna didn't look good to me, either in appearance or his performance.
Garcia did look good but I don't think he had the best version of Fortuna in front of him either.

That's actually a good point. You can lose explosiveness. I guess I should have said power operates on a bell curve, where at some point, the excessive weight has diminishing returns. Yeah. Fortuna is more of a 130 pound guy. That's where he fought at most of his career. But I've seen guys rehydrate to the 150 pound range before, while fighting at lightweight. Linares rehydrated to 152 while at lightweight. Haney rehydrates to about 157. So I suppose it's possible that Fortuna wasn't at his best going into the ring. He must have let himself go since last he fought, if he couldn't make the weight.
